Course Building
Teachable allows you to set up your course without being too complex. Even even if you don’t have a experience in the field of technical or design, you won’t experience any issues making use of Teachable.
You can add your thumbnail while organizing your segments. You can organize them in any way you want and include lectures, regardless of whether they are in PDF, video or audio format.
Furthermore, you could make your lectures available over a period of period of time using their Drip feature. You can have it based on the number of days after you’ve signed up.
You can also make Authors. Authors are those who are able to modify the courses in the way they wish. This helps groups to set up their online courses in a group. The platform will help to manage the course easily.
There’s also the possibility of adding quizzes with multiple choices. However, you need to add your questions one by one as Teachable does not have a feature that allows you to import bulk quiz questions.
Teachable also allows you to make certificates with their templates or by creating them from scratch. However, if you wish to create them from scratch, then you must learn to do it by using the liquid code language or HTML.

Payment and Pricing Options
It is not necessary to purchase a third-party payment processor when you’re using Teachable. They have a built-in payment processor, which is accessible through Teachable Payments. But, they charge the payment of a fee per payout. You’ll need to pay $0.25 each time, however.

Basic Plan
Its Basic Plan costs $39 per month and includes an 5% commission on each sale. If you choose to bill each year, you’ll only have to pay $29 per month.
Access to most important features, including the built-in emails marketing tool, as well as an affiliate program, customized coupons, domains, and drip content.
If you are paid via their system, you might have to wait for a while. There are delays that can range between 30 and 60 days. Additionally, the deposits are only once per month.

Pro Plan
If you’re not too interested in paying sales commissions and other fees, then you’ll find that the Pro Plan would be better for you. With a monthly cost of $99, you get all the features you require from the base plan, plus some additions to elevate your business to the next level.
You’ll also have access to more advanced theme customizations and analytics. Also, you’ll be able to access your revenues instantly.
Additionally, they will also prioritize your request for support. While a wait time of 6 hours isn’t ideal however, it’s far more than the typical 12 hours.
Business Plan
If you find it difficult to use the Pro Plan lacking features, then maybe your business needs to consider the Business Plan. It’s the highest pricing option available in Teachable, amounting to $249 per month.
There are no sales fees involved when you buy this plan.
This is the best option for those who run a larger school and offer many classes.
The Business Plan lets you have two hours of priority response time for support inquiries and 2 one-hour onboarding sessions to set up your business.
You can add the authors up to with this plan. In addition, it also allows the bulk enrollment of as well as import student.

Does the certification have an expiring date?
The certificates issued by Teachable are not valid for expiry. However, they can be either active or not. If a student successfully completes the course, they’ll get access to the certification. If a student decides to withdraw from the course the course, they’ll be considered inactive and cannot access the certificate.
